Germany Digital Identity In Education Market Summary

As per Market Research Future analysis, the Germany Digital Identity In Education Market size was estimated at 137.09 USD Million in 2024. The Digital Identity-in-education market is projected to grow from 165.04 USD Million in 2025 to 1056.13 USD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 20.3%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035

Germany Digital Identity In Education Market Drivers

Rising Demand for Secure Access

The digital identity-in-education market is experiencing a notable increase in demand for secure access solutions. Educational institutions in Germany are prioritizing the protection of sensitive student data, which has led to a surge in the implementation of robust identity verification systems. According to recent statistics, approximately 70% of educational organizations are investing in advanced security measures to safeguard personal information. This trend is driven by the need to comply with stringent data protection regulations, such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R). As a result, The digital identity-in-education market is expected to expand as institutions seek reliable solutions that ensure secure access to educational resources.

Government Initiatives and Funding

Government initiatives play a crucial role in shaping the digital identity-in-education market. In Germany, various funding programs are being introduced to support the development and implementation of digital identity solutions in educational settings. For instance, the Federal Ministry of Education and Research has allocated €100 million to enhance digital infrastructure in schools, which includes identity management systems. This financial backing encourages educational institutions to adopt innovative technologies that streamline identity verification processes. Consequently, the digital identity-in-education market is poised for growth as government support fosters an environment conducive to technological advancement.

Biometric (Dominant) vs. Non-biometric (Emerging)

In the Germany digital identity-in-education market, biometric solutions are regarded as the dominant force due to their robust security features and user-friendly biometric authentication methods. These solutions, including fingerprint and facial recognition, align well with the demands for accuracy and reliability in identity verification. On the other hand, non-biometric solutions are emerging as an appealing alternative, offering functionalities that cater to diverse educational needs. These may encompass PINs, passwords, and security questions, fostering flexibility and simplicity in user engagement. As educational institutions navigate towards more inclusive and adaptable identity management systems, the non-biometric segment is expected to expand significantly, appealing to entities that prioritize cost-effectiveness while maintaining essential security measures.

Industry Developments

In recent months, the Germany Digital Identity in Education Market has seen significant developments, particularly with major players such as SAP, Deutsche Telekom, and Microsoft taking leading roles in enhancing digital identity solutions. The market has been impacted by Germany's increased emphasis on data privacy and security following the implementation of the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) in 2018. This has accelerated the adoption of digital identity solutions within educational institutions.

In June 2023, SAP announced a collaboration with educational authorities to streamline identity verification processes for students, enhancing data security. Furthermore, in August 2023, Deutsche Telekom launched a new digital identity verification platform aimed at educational users to improve access to e-learning resources securely.

In terms of mergers and acquisitions, there have been no notable transactions recently involving key players like Unisys, IBM, and Oracle within this sector. However, growth in market valuation is apparent as investments in digital identity technologies continue to rise, reflecting a strong emphasis on secure educational frameworks. The landscape continues to evolve, driven by government initiatives and technological advancements aimed at increasing efficiencies in educational settings in Germany.
